The global market for Automotive Microcontroller Unit (MCU) was valued at US$ 6329 million in the year 2024 and is projected to reach a revised size of US$ 11260 million by 2031, growing at a CAGR of 8.7% during the forecast period.
An Automotive Microcontroller Unit (MCU) is a critical electronic component found in modern vehicles that serves as the brain of the vehicle"s electronic control systems. It"s a specialized microcontroller designed to control various functions and systems within an automobile. These functions can range from managing engine control to handling safety systems, communication modules, entertainment systems, and more.
Automotive is a key driver of this industry. According to data from the World Automobile Organization (OICA), global automobile production and sales in 2017 reached their peak in the past 10 years, at 97.3 million and 95.89 million respectively. In 2018, the global economic expansion ended, and the global auto market declined as a whole. In 2022, there will wear units 81.6 million vehicles in the world. At present, more than 90% of the world"s automobiles are concentrated in the three continents of Asia, Europe and North America, of which Asia automobile production accounts for 56% of the world, Europe accounts for 20%, and North America accounts for 16%. The world major automobile producing countries include China, the United States, Japan, South Korea, Germany, India, Mexico, and other countries; among them, China is the largest automobile producing country in the world, accounting for about 32%. Japan is the world"s largest car exporter, exporting more than 3.5 million vehicles in 2022.
